Understanding Pilates
Pilates is a low-impact exercise method designed to improve flexibility, strength, and overall body awareness. It was developed by Joseph Pilates in the early 20th century and has since evolved into a globally recognized fitness practice. The primary focus of Pilates is on core strength, but it also incorporates elements of balance, coordination, and controlled breathing.
Unlike high-intensity workouts that may put excessive strain on the body, Pilates is gentle yet highly effective. It caters to individuals of all fitness levels, from beginners to seasoned athletes. The controlled movements help improve posture, enhance muscle tone, and prevent injuries, making it a versatile exercise option for people of all ages.
Benefits of Virtual Pilates Sessions
With advancements in technology and the increasing demand for home-based fitness solutions, virtual Pilates classes have become a preferred choice for many individuals. Below are some key benefits of opting for online Pilates classes:
1. Flexibility and Convenience
One of the most significant advantages of taking virtual Pilates sessions is the ability to work out at any time and place. Unlike traditional studio classes, which require travel and fixed schedules, online sessions allow participants to join live classes or access pre-recorded workouts at their convenience. This flexibility ensures that fitness goals can be maintained without disrupting daily commitments.
2. Cost-Effectiveness
Attending in-person Pilates sessions can be costly, especially when factoring in membership fees, transportation, and additional expenses. Online options provide an affordable alternative by eliminating commuting costs and often offering budget-friendly subscription plans. Many platforms even provide free trial periods or single-class purchases, making it easy for users to find a plan that suits their financial situation.
3. Personalized Experience
Many online Pilates platforms offer a range of classes tailored to different needs. Whether an individual seeks a beginner-friendly session, an advanced workout, or a specialized class for rehabilitation, there are numerous choices available. Some programs also provide interactive features, such as virtual instructor guidance, modifications for different skill levels, and real-time feedback to enhance the learning experience.
4. Comfort and Privacy
For those who feel self-conscious about exercising in a public setting, virtual classes provide a comfortable and private environment. Whether practicing in a living room, bedroom, or dedicated home gym space, individuals can focus entirely on their workout without external distractions. This setting allows for greater confidence and enjoyment in the exercise process.
5. Variety of Instructors and Styles
Online platforms bring together experienced instructors from all over the world, offering a diverse range of teaching styles and class formats. Users can explore different instructors, class durations, and techniques to find a program that best aligns with their fitness preferences. This variety keeps workouts engaging and prevents monotony, ensuring sustained motivation over time.
6. Safe and Guided Workouts
While some people worry that home workouts may increase the risk of injury, most online Pilates programs are designed with safety in mind. Professional instructors provide detailed explanations, modifications for different fitness levels, and tips on maintaining proper form. Additionally, many platforms offer support communities where participants can ask questions and seek advice.
How to Get Started with Virtual Pilates
If you’re considering adding Pilates to your fitness routine, starting with virtual classes is simple. Here are a few steps to help you begin:
-
Choose a Reliable Platform – Research different online fitness platforms that offer Pilates sessions. Look for user reviews, instructor credentials, and available class formats.
-
Determine Your Fitness Level – Identify whether you are a beginner, intermediate, or advanced practitioner. This will help you select appropriate classes that align with your experience level.
-
Ensure Proper Equipment – While many Pilates exercises can be performed using just a mat, some sessions may require additional equipment such as resistance bands, stability balls, or light weights. Check class descriptions to see what is needed.
-
Set Up a Dedicated Space – Create a comfortable workout area at home with enough room to move freely. A quiet and well-lit space will enhance your overall experience.
-
Follow a Consistent Schedule – To maximize results, aim to incorporate Pilates into your routine regularly. Setting specific workout times can help establish a habit and ensure long-term commitment.
-
Listen to Your Body – Pay attention to how your body responds to each session. Start with beginner-friendly classes if necessary and gradually progress to more challenging workouts as you build strength and flexibility.
